The Environmental Health and Safety Manager is responsible for developing implementing and maintaining workplace safety health and environmental programs in compliance with OSHA (United States) and WorkSafe (Canada) regulations. This role ensures the safety of employees adherence to legal requirements and the continuous improvement of all safety initiatives across offices production facilities and fleet operations.


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S
Safety Manager ResponsibilitiesUnited States:
OSHA Compliance:

-Implement and maintain workplace safety programs to comply with OSHA standards rules and regulations.
-Reports OSHA Reportable injuries to OSHA within 8 hours.
-Accurately record all OSHA Recordable injuries for year-end reporting and filing.
-Maintain and update OSHA 300 301 and 300A forms ensuring all work-related injuries and illnesses are properly documented for inspection and submission as required by OSHAs recordkeeping rules.

-The main point of contact for OHSA compliance officers and manages all OSHA inspections.

Conduct Safety Audits and Inspections:

-Inspect workplaces to identify hazards ensure safety systems are in place and verify compliance with federal state and local safety regulations.
Workers Compensation Claims Management:

-Respond promptly to workplace injuries ensuring proper care and accurate incident reporting.

-Assist employees with the workers compensation claims process and coordinate communication with insurance providers.

-Maintain claim records and monitor progress supporting return-to-work efforts when appropriate.
-Collaborate with HR and supervisors on claims management and case resolution.
-Use claims data to identify trends and recommend safety improvements.
Develop and Update Safety Policies:
-Create and update safety manuals operating procedures and emergency response plans.
Employee Training:
-Develop and conduct safety training sessions on hazard recognition equipment use PPE and emergency procedures.

Incident Investigation:
-Respond to accidents and near-misses lead investigations determine root causes document findings and implement corrective actions.
Promote Safety Culture:
-Lead initiatives that drive a safety-first mindset and encourage employee involvement in safety programs.
Collaboration:
-Serve as a liaison with external regulators and internal teams to address safety issues and regulatory updates.
Maintain Safety Equipment:
-Oversee the provision and proper use of safety equipment including PPE and emergency kits.


Safety Manager ResponsibilitiesCanada
Ensure WorkSafe Compliance:
-Implement health and safety programs in compliance with provincial regulations and WorkSafe Provinces.
-Work directly with WorkSafe regulators during inspections consultations or investigations; represent the employer in these matters.
-Review and respond to inspection reports addressing any compliance orders as required.
-Communicate inspection findings and safety information to all employees ensuring everyone is aware of hazards and corrective actions. Encourage reporting of hazards and participation in safety initiatives.
-File reports with relevant WorkSafe agencies when an injury occurs.
Develop and Enforce Safety Policies:
-Craft and enforce safety policies/procedures specific to workplace risks; tailor them for jobsites and work tasks.
Conduct Safety Inspections:
-Routinely inspect facilities and jobsites to identify hazards address deficiencies and ensure regulatory compliance.
Provide Training:
-Organize and deliver training programs on safe work practices regulatory requirements and emergency procedures.
Incident Response and Investigation:
-Investigate work-related incidents and guide corrective/preventive actions.
Promote Safety Culture:
-Foster safety awareness and encourage employee participation in safety initiatives; recognize safe behavior.
Documentation and Reporting:
-Maintain comprehensive records of incidents training inspections and compliance efforts as required by provincial law.
Emergency Preparedness:
-Ensure emergency response plans and drills are in place and that first aid equipment/staff are available.
Support and Supervise:
Provide support and guidance to supervisors and workers ensuring all team members understand and carry out their health and safety responsibilities.
